How do you say "field hockey" in Arabic?

هوكي

Hwki

Noun Arabic script

In Arabic, "field hockey" is هوكي.

Pronunciation

One word: 'HOO-kee' with stress on the first syllable. Both vowels are long.

Writing and usage

The word uses 'ha', 'waw', 'kaf', 'ya'. It's a borrowed term from English adapted to Arabic.

Example sentence

الهوكي على الحقل

Hockey is on the field.
